I monetized my side project which can now cover about 30-40% of my monthly costs + I went into freelancing so I would now change company / project every 4 to 12 months, so it never gets boring too long (if it starts to get boring and the project doesn't need me, I don't extend the contract and look for a new project).
I think being a contract freelancer also helped me detach emotionally from work; I do work, they pay me, it's a simple transaction. Unless you own a stake in the company, it's the same for employees. My side project works a lot with environmental non governmental organizations, but my freelance work has sent me to e.g. online shop for luxury jewelry, or a big retailer or several agencies working for global Fortune 500 type companies.
